From the Pastor

Jesus said, ...'I will build my church, and the gates of hell will not overcome it." (Matthew 16:18b) While our salvation is very personal, Jesus declared that the church would be the avenue that hewould work through, for he declared that in building his church he would give us the "keys to the kingdom of heaven" (Matthew 16:19). Then in his last words he gave us the commission to "make disciples" ( Matthew 28:19). We here at Elizabeth City First Church of the Nazarene take this commission very seriously. Not only are we devoted to world and local missions, but our worship, study and fellowship, we believe, are under the annointing of the Holy Spirit. Our greatest desire is to be Jesus, not only to a dying world, but to one another. We declare, "In him (Christ) the whole building is joined together and rises to become a holy temple, in the Lord. And in him you too are being built together to become a dwelling in which God lives by his Spirit." (Ephesians 2:21, 22)

Pastor Marty Cunningham
